Output 8ba51174cc28302a7313951cba75acaa1cff79f147fb3b008fb1c1933a904f41:2

value
2086153
script pubkey
OP_0 OP_PUSHBYTES_32 7dd57dd9cd5517936fc98a347c7f121c3eebd89b53009f9ba1749e36a97300c9
address
bc1q0h2hmkwd25texm7f3g68clcjrslwhkym2vqflxapwj0rd2tnqryshgdh4d
transaction
8ba51174cc28302a7313951cba75acaa1cff79f147fb3b008fb1c1933a904f41
confirmations
145330
spent
true